Does anyone have a suggestion as to how to keep a dog out of a flower garden?

you can dig a 2'x2' spot and fill it with sand, then bury the dogs favorite toy about half way and take the dog to this spot. do this as often as possible for a couple of days or so, till he learns that is his digging spot. in the mean time sprinkle black pepper here and there in the garden. do NOT use anything hot, as the dog cannot get rid of hot pepper in his mouth or in his nose. (it suffers terribly) black pepper is strong enough and after one or two times he will know to stay away.

if you do these two things consecutively you should have a well trained pooch in just a few days.

hope this helps.

Reply:I recently asked Farmers Almanac this same question and they told me to put moth balls, or citrus (lemon peel, orange peel), or to simply lay larger sized rocks throughout as beautification and the dog will not fit in there to dig. I simply bordered my hostas with sandstones and my LARGE dog now stays clear... Good Luck.
